Cyclic Hemiacetal
A molecule formed from the reaction between an aldehyde and an alcohol resulting in a ring structure containing an oxygen atom.
Ring Oxygen
An oxygen atom that is incorporated into a cyclic structure, often contributing to the ring's chemical properties.
Haworth Structure
A way of representing cyclic sugars as planar rings, focusing on the arrangement of hydroxyl groups around the ring, used in carbohydrate chemistry.
β-D-Glucopyranose
A chemical structure of glucose in its cyclic form, where the glucose molecule forms a six-membered ring, with the hydroxyl group on the first carbon in the beta configuration.
